SleepyDrug Posted July 3, 2003 Report Share Posted July 3, 2003 Design Question: Why do all MA attacks have an even damage bonus? defensive strike (+ 0), martial strike (+ 2), offensive strike (+ 4) Is there a reason no strikes do +1d6 or +3d6? Monolith Posted July 3, 2003 Report Share Posted July 3, 2003 There are some maneuvers which add +1 DC. Legsweep is an example of this. Reversal and Root also add +15, which is an odd number too. Even is much more common though and I do not think there is any reason for it besides symetry to the eyes.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
misterdeath Posted July 3, 2003 Report Share Posted July 3, 2003 I've always figured that it was do to the Killing Damage/Martial Manuever thing. When you use your maneuver with a killing attack (my martial arts style uses pole arms), you divide the DC by 2 to get the damage. By having Martial Strike + 2DC and Offensive Strike + 4 DC, then you don't have the whole half DC/round down thing. Martial Strike with fist == Str + 2DC. Martial Strike with naginata == Weapon damage + DC from maneuver + modified strength. Nothing prevents you from loading up +3 DC maneuvers, just realize that if you go with a weapon style, they get dropped. D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
